Looks like it's time to summarize the current strat model so we know what we talk about:



Default downtime for all field targets and HQ is 30 minutes, all factory and city targets is 60 minutes. This could change or have already been changed of course.

I am also a beleaver that there should be strat, but not a super detailed monstrosity.

Keep it somewhat simple.

But, I do think a few more do-dads would be nice.

I am a fan of the "trickle down" economics idea thats been batted around.  The home base produces all the supplies, then is carted to all the rest of the bases/cities by means of supply convoys (trucks, trains, cargo ships, ect).

However, one other idea that is known to be true sooner or latter are ground forces.  Tanks and trucks are slated to be included sooner or latter.  Player controlled ones.  This may lead to things like roads and bridges.
